This role is responsible for the decontamination, sterilization, and preparation of instruments and patient care equipment at ASC Manhasset. Key duties include restocking crash carts, issuing supplies, operating sterilization equipment, and maintaining documentation for regulatory compliance. The position also involves assuming departmental responsibility in the absence of the Supervisor or Director.

Requirements

  • High School or GED
  • Certified and Registered Central Service Technician (HSPA) OR Certification from the Certification for Sterile Processing and Distribution (CBSP)
  • 5 years of Sterile Processing Tech experience
  • Basic knowledge of aseptic techniques and procedures, sterilization techniques and procedures, infection control and workflow principles and requirements, equipment and supply processing.
  • Knowledge of all medical and surgical equipment and supplies within a hospital setting and the ability to identify items and ensure accuracy against catalog listing of surgical instruments and equipment.
  • Exercises responsible judgment to provide necessary supplies and equipment for patient care.
  • Familiarity with a variety of surgical equipment, including but not limited to: dental, optometry/ophthalmology, orthopedics, neurosurgery, gastroenterology, ENT, GYN, cardiology, dermatology, urology, podiatry, and general surgery.
  • Qualified candidates must be able to effectively communicate with all levels of the organization.

Responsibilities

  • Performs other duties as assigned
  • Oversees and assigns the workload each shift, ensuring priority and loaner trays and equipment are processed and ready for scheduled cases in accordance with departmental policies and procedures.
  • Reports issues or concerns to department supervisors for resolution in a timely manner.
  • Assumes responsibility for the department in absence of the Supervisor or Director.
  • Follows proper procedure for biological monitoring of sterilizers as per regulatory and hospital requirements.
  • Responsible for daily review, compliance, and maintenance of all sterilization and biological monitoring records.
  • Responsible for Sterility Assurance through the use of appropriate chemical and biological indicators and verification of sterilizer parameters.
  • Responsible for the understanding of the functionality and appropriate use of the Sterrad Sterilization System, precautions, and compatibility of scopes and electronic equipment.
  • Responsible for the understanding of the functionality and appropriate use of the Washer Decontaminator and chemical detergent and additive dilutions.
  • Responsible for the appropriate handling and processing of Contaminated Instruments and equipment.
  • Responsible for the proper identification, functionality, and preparation of surgical instruments for all hospital services.
  • Responsible for the proper Supply Distribution.
